The screenwriter can submit the film through the following steps: 1. Decide on the genre and project of the movie you want to submit. 2. To find a suitable film project for submission, you can obtain information through the film database, film website, film agency, or the social media account of the film producer. 3 Read the submission guide for the film project to understand the submission requirements and deadline. 4. Prepare the submission materials, including the script, author's certificate, personal contact information, copyright statement, etc. 5. Submit the submission materials to the website or organization of the film project you want to submit. 6 Waiting for a reply from the film project may take some time until you receive a reply or confirm that the submission is successful. Please note that the requirements and policies of each film project may be different. Therefore, please read the submission guidelines of the film project and understand the relevant submission policies before submitting.

If you want to submit a movie script, you can refer to the following steps: Writing a script: First, you have to write a complete script, including the storyline, characters, scenes, and so on. Make sure that the structure and language of the script can attract the audience and dig deep into the theme and emotion of the story. 2. Decide on the type of script: According to the style and type of the script, determine whether the script is suitable for film production. For example, a comedy script might be more suitable for television or radio, while an epic script might be more suitable for movies. 3. Find a suitable film company or producer: After determining the type and style of the script, you can find a suitable film company or producer and submit it to them. You can search for the name of the film company or producer on the Internet or send an email directly to those who are interested. 4. Prepare the script: Prepare the script before submitting it to the film company or producer. He needed to prepare the script's text, pictures, music, and video clips. Make sure that the script has no grammar or spellings errors and that the story is clearly conveyed. 5. Submit the script: After completing the preparation of the script, you can submit the script to the film company or producer. You will need to submit the screenplay in a PDF-version with all relevant information attached. You can submit the script online or mail it to the film company or producer's office. Accept the script: The film company or producer may conduct a preliminary review of the script and decide whether to accept the submission based on the results of the review. If the script is accepted, it may be invited for further review and discussion to determine the final version of the film. The submission of a movie script required sufficient preparation and hard work to be successful. I hope these steps will help!

The creation of a movie plot usually involved two parts: the director and the scriptwriter. The director was responsible for directing the movie to convey the story and emotions through the language of the camera and the performance of the scene. During the creative process, the director had to consider the overall visual style, shooting scene, special effects, and other aspects of the film to ensure that the film could present the best effect. The scriptwriter was responsible for writing the movie script and turning the director's ideas into words to make the movie's storyline clear. The scriptwriter needed to create the script according to the theme, plot, characters, and other factors of the movie. The script would be submitted to the director and producer for review and modification. Therefore, the director and screenwriter played an important role in the creation of the movie plot. The two needed to work closely together to create an excellent movie.
